summaryrefslogtreecommitdiff
path: root/drivers/media/i2c/ov5647.c
AgeCommit message (Expand)AuthorFilesLines
2024-08-09media: Drop explicit initialization of struct i2c_device_id::driver_data to 0Uwe Kleine-König1-1/+1
2024-06-15media: i2c: ov5647: replacing of_node_put with __free(device_node)Abdulrasaq Lawani1-7/+4
2024-02-23media: i2c: replace of_graph_get_next_endpoint()Kuninori Morimoto1-1/+1
2023-11-23media: v4l: subdev: Switch to stream-aware state functionsSakari Ailus1-6/+6
2023-09-27media: i2c: ov5647: Drop check for reentrant .s_stream()Laurent Pinchart1-6/+0
2023-05-25media: Switch i2c drivers back to use .probe()Uwe Kleine-König1-1/+1
2023-03-20media: i2c: ov5647: Use bus-locked i2c_transfer()Jacopo Mondi1-12/+18
2023-03-20media: i2c: ov5647: Add test pattern controlValentine Barshak1-1/+25
2022-08-16i2c: Make remove callback return voidUwe Kleine-König1-3/+1
2021-06-17media: v4l2-subdev: add subdev-wide state structTomi Valkeinen1-12/+14
2021-05-19media: i2c: ov5647: use pm_runtime_resume_and_get()Mauro Carvalho Chehab1-4/+5
2021-01-12media: ov5647: Remove 640x480 SBGGR8 modeJacopo Mondi1-171/+9
2021-01-12media: ov5647: Support VIDIOC_SUBSCRIBE_EVENTJacopo Mondi1-0/+3
2021-01-12media: ov5647: Constify oe_enable/disable reglistJacopo Mondi1-2/+2
2021-01-12media: ov5647: Apply controls only when poweredJacopo Mondi1-17/+27
2021-01-12media: ov5647: Rework s_stream() operationJacopo Mondi1-2/+31
2021-01-12media: ov5647: Use pm_runtime infrastructureJacopo Mondi1-71/+71
2021-01-12media: ov5647: Advertise the correct exposure rangeDave Stevenson1-4/+35
2021-01-12media: ov5647: Support V4L2_CID_VBLANK controlDave Stevenson1-4/+46
2021-01-12media: ov5647: Support V4L2_CID_HBLANK controlJacopo Mondi1-1/+26
2021-01-12media: ov5647: Support V4L2_CID_PIXEL_RATEDave Stevenson1-11/+32
2021-01-12media: ov5647: Set V4L2_SUBDEV_FL_HAS_EVENTS flagDave Stevenson1-1/+1
2021-01-12media: ov5647: Implement set_fmt pad operationJacopo Mondi1-4/+62
2021-01-12media: ov5647: Use SBGGR10_1X10 640x480 as defaultJacopo Mondi1-3/+3
2021-01-12media: ov5647: Add SGGBR10_1X10 modesJacopo Mondi1-0/+441
2021-01-12media: ov5647: Rename SBGGR8 VGA modeJacopo Mondi1-6/+7
2021-01-12media: ov5647: Add support for get_selection()Dave Stevenson1-23/+71
2021-01-12media: ov5647: Break out format handlingJacopo Mondi1-26/+65
2021-01-12media: ov5647: Rationalize driver structure nameJacopo Mondi1-23/+23
2021-01-12media: ov5647: Support gain, exposure and AWB controlsDavid Plowman1-2/+170
2021-01-12media: ov5647: Protect s_stream() with mutexJacopo Mondi1-2/+9
2021-01-12media: ov5647: Implement enum_frame_size()Jacopo Mondi1-3/+22
2021-01-12media: ov5647: Program mode at s_stream(1) timeJacopo Mondi1-37/+44
2021-01-12media: ov5647: Fix return value from read/writeJacopo Mondi1-4/+8
2021-01-12media: ov5647: Replace license with SPDX identifierJacopo Mondi1-9/+1
2021-01-12media: ov5647: Fix style issuesJacopo Mondi1-55/+47
2021-01-12media: ov5647: Fix format initializationJacopo Mondi1-3/+2
2021-01-12media: ov5647: Add set_fmt and get_fmt calls.Dave Stevenson1-0/+19
2021-01-12media: ov5647: Add support for non-continuous clock modeDave Stevenson1-4/+20
2021-01-12media: ov5647: Add support for PWDN GPIO.Dave Stevenson1-0/+32
2019-08-13media: i2c: Convert to new i2c device probe()Kieran Bingham1-3/+2
2018-10-04media: v4l: fwnode: Initialise the V4L2 fwnode endpoints to zeroSakari Ailus1-1/+1
2017-11-30media: drivers: remove "/**" from non-kernel-doc commentsMauro Carvalho Chehab1-2/+2
2017-10-27media: i2c: OV5647: change to use macro for the registersJacob Chen1-16/+26
2017-10-27media: i2c: OV5647: ensure clock lane in LP-11 state before streaming onJacob Chen1-1/+12
2017-06-06[media] v4l: Switch from V4L2 OF not V4L2 fwnode APISakari Ailus1-3/+4
2017-04-14[media] media: i2c: Add support for OV5647 sensorRamiro Oliveira1-0/+634